Look, I’ve been roofing these hills for over twenty years, and I can tell you Rutherford College sits right in a bullseye for trouble. We’re tucked in that valley between the South Mountains and the Brushy range, and that geography acts like a funnel for spring storms. When those cold fronts come barreling down from the northwest in March and April, they slam into the warm, humid air that pools in the lowlands, and the whole sky just stacks up. That’s when we get those classic, violent supercells that drop hail the size of golf balls—sometimes bigger—and straight-line winds that’ll peel shingles right off a deck. It’s not a matter of if, but when, and I’ve seen roofs that looked fine in October completely shredded by the time May rolls around.
And it’s not just the spring. We get those pop-up thunderstorms in July and August that seem to come out of nowhere, but they’re the sneaky ones. The hail might be smaller, but the wind gusts can hit sixty or seventy miles an hour, and they hit at a weird angle because of how the terrain channels them. That’s what really does the damage—it lifts the edges of your shingles and drives the rain sideways right underneath. Plus, the constant freeze-thaw cycles in the winter here, with the ice and the heavy wet snow, they weaken the sealant on your roof. So by the time a big hail storm rolls through, your shingles are already brittle and ready to crack. Honestly, if you’ve got a roof that’s over ten years old, you’re playing with fire in this town.
